The Importance of Writing Clean and Efficient MATLAB Code

Efficient code is easier to understand, debug, and maintain. Students should focus on proper variable naming, modular programming, comments, and optimized algorithms instead of simply making a program work. These practices not only improve assignment grades but also prepare students for real-world programming projects. Developing Better Problem-Solving Skills

MATLAB assignments are designed to test analytical thinking rather than memorization. Students often need to convert mathematical equations into executable code while ensuring logical accuracy. Breaking complex problems into smaller functions, testing code incrementally, and validating outputs are effective ways to improve programming skills. Best Practices for Completing MATLAB Assignments

Students can improve their MATLAB assignments by following several proven strategies:

  • Understand the assignment requirements before coding.
  • Divide large problems into smaller modules.
  • Test each function independently.
  • Use MATLAB's debugging and visualization tools.
  • Write readable and well-documented code.
  • Validate results using sample datasets.
  • Optimize code only after ensuring correctness.
